Output e0397656c5eac950f7c4585f6044d738b26bbcc3d6301c41a8154b30032b4c6c:0

value
535388660
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eda7518255aefcb2ddf5e28868ad334811290cb8 OP_EQUALVERIFY OP_CHECKSIG
address
1Nfbax5oMTLLa7Jw2TfF1hVfjjgkLpRUSX
transaction
e0397656c5eac950f7c4585f6044d738b26bbcc3d6301c41a8154b30032b4c6c
spent
true